Hi release folks! We're moving the Pinewheel build off the old make-soup setup onto the Kilnworks hermetic system. Short version for you: release candidates should come from Kilnworks starting next cycle, and the old artifacts will stop being signed after that. If a build looks different (sizes shift slightly — that's expected), check the migration tracker page before panicking. Day-to-day questions go to whoever's on the build rotation, but for anything release-blocking, skip the queue and write to the migration leads directly.

escalation mailbox, bafog-fafog: ulador@paliqlabs.internal

## Onboarding: The Lookaside Filter in Cobblestone

Before any read hits the Cobblestone key-value store, it passes through a bloom filter maintained by the `sieve-gate` service. This avoids disk seeks for keys we know are absent, which matters at our read volumes. The filter is rebuilt nightly from the compaction logs; false positives are tolerated, false negatives must never occur, so treat rebuild failures as pageable. To run `sieve-gate` locally, copy `env.sample` to `.env` and add the store's access credential on the next line:

secret setting of yagef-baweg: RELAY_SECRET29=cb53deb59a49ed54d9f43599b54ca

TURN-208: Gatevale turnstile counters at the Merrow Field pilot double-count when a rotation reverses mid-cycle. Attendance totals drift roughly 2% high per event. The debounce window fix is implemented, reviewed by Ilsa, and soak-tested across two simulated match days without drift. Ready for your cut; the candidate build is identified below.

trace token, tagag-tafog: htk6_5ed18c

Subject: RateParity ownership change

Team — effective Monday, ownership of the Gullwharf rate-parity checker moves out of the Bookings pod. This covers the scraper schedulers, the parity-diff engine, and the weekly mismatch digest. New folks: this tool compares our published rates against partner channels and flags drift over 2%. Open incidents transfer as-is; no triage backlog reset. Runbooks are unchanged, docs live in the Gullwharf wiki space. All escalations, reviews, and parity-rule changes now go to the person named below.

account owner for bawip-tahag: Raleth Quenok